Red Thai Curry

Recipe:
1 tablespoon olive oil
1/2 onion, sliced
4 garlic cloves, minced
1 potato, cubed
1 can garbanzo beans, drained
1 can coconut milk
2 tablespoons red curry paste
2 tablespoons sugar
1 teaspoon soy sauce
1/2 cup water
salt to taste ( about 1/2-1 teaspoon)
1 cup spinach
Directions:
Sauté onion and garlic with olive oil on a medium heat. Add potatoes, garbanzo beans, coconut milk, red curry paste, sugar, soy sauce, and water and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low and add the spinach. Cover for 15 minutes while simmering on low. Remove from heat and salt as needed. Eat over brown or white rice.
